The client required an expansion for their childcare facility and the flexibility to transport the new prefabricated structure to a temporary site. In response, RSAAW designed a CLT module After School Care Pod that offers easy assembly at the new location. Furthermore, it can be later transported back to the original school grounds, providing a versatile solution.

The CLT module is designed to Passive House standards for superior thermal performance. All materials in the prefabricated assemblies are designed to be taken apart and reused or recycled as required.

The After School Care Pod allows for a gallery/lobby entry, cubby hall, offices, play/learning area, and ample windows to provide supervision and daylighting. The cladding system features a playful colour study intended to stimulate and be easily recognizable by children.

The use of primary shapes and forms in the building elements gives opportunities for imagination and education. Such elements provide stimulating play areas to challenge balance and other early childhood development fundamentals. These engaging opportunities offer an environment for play-based exploration and learning.

As a prefabricated childcare centre prototype, current risk-adverse commercial models were evaluated. Additionally, reassessed superseded early childhood rationales were taken into consideration.
